Idea of coordinate system for a vector space V: (and generalized beyond two dimensions), Coordinate system for a vector space V is specified by generators a_1, \dots, a_n of V. Every vector v in V can be written as a linear combination. v = \alpha_1 a_1 + \dots + \alpha_n a_n. WebApr 10, 2024 · A polar coordinate system locates a point by its direction relative to a reference direction and its distance from a given point, also the origin. Such a system is used in radar or sonar tracking and is the basis of bearing-and-range navigation systems. In three dimensions, it leads to cylindrical and spherical coordinates. WebRectangular coordinates specify a position in space in a given coordinate system as an ordered 3-tuple of real numbers, ( x, y, z ), with respect to the origin (0,0,0). Considerations for choosing the origin are discussed in Global and Local Coordinate Systems. You can view the 3-tuple as a point in space, or equivalently as a vector in three ...
